Falkirk vs Hibernian Prediction

Falkirk vs Hibs: A Case for the Under?

Preview

Right then, let's have a proper look at this mid-table Premiership tussle. Falkirk host Hibernian, and if you're expecting a goal-fest, you might want to put your money back in your pocket. This one has 'cagey' written all over it.

Falkirk are sitting 6th, five points behind 5th-placed Hibs. On paper, it's a chance to close the gap. On the grass, Falkirk have forgotten how to score, especially at home. Their last ten games tell the story: just five goals scored. That's one every other game. At home? It's even worse – a miserly 0.25 goals per game. They've nicked wins against the likes of St Mirren and Aberdeen recently, but the standout results are the 0-1 loss to Celtic and that gutsy 1-1 draw away at league leaders Hearts in the cup. The problem is clear: a defence that's actually quite solid (eight goals conceded in ten, five clean sheets) is being let down by an attack that's gone on holiday.

Hibernian, meanwhile, are a bit of a puzzle. They smashed Falkirk 3-0 just last month and have put three past Kilmarnock and two past Aberdeen and Hearts. But then they go and lose 1-0 away to Dunfermline in the FA Cup. Their away form is all over the shop: one win in their last five on the road, scoring just 0.8 goals per game. They create chances – their shot accuracy away is a decent 41% – but they're also conceding 1.2 per game on their travels.

So what happens when a team that can't score meets a team that's inconsistent away? History says goals – the head-to-head has seen both teams score in 7 of the last 9 meetings. But form is a louder shout. Falkirk's recent matches are low-scoring affairs. Look at the scores: 0-1, 0-2, 1-0, 0-1, 0-0. It's a pattern.

The numbers back it up. Falkirk average just 12 shots a game, with less than a third on target. Hibs are better in front of goal away, but they're not prolific. The goal expectancy models are whispering about 1.5 goals total. The bookies have Under 2.5 Goals at 1.80. Sometimes the maths is simple: one team can't hit a barn door at home, the other isn't much better on the road. Add in the fact both sides have had a full week's rest, and this could be a tactical, tight midfield battle.
